ANALYSIS/OPINION:
This week’s social media ban of President Trump and other conservatives isn’t a violation of the First Amendment. It is a violation of common sense and the precedent it sets is no less scary. 
The First Amendment prohibits government censorship of speech, rather than decisions by private companies. But the censorship of certain users by powerful tech companies companies aligned with one political party still set off alarm bells across the ideological spectrum. The ACLU warned of the “unchecked power” of Big Tech after Twitter’s ban of President Trump; even German Chancellor Angela Merkel, no fan of the president, said the move was concerning.  ....
